Subject: Tracing key rotation — heads up, new folks!

Hi all — quick note: we're rotating the key the Spanwick tracer uses to ship spans between our microservices. If your local setup suddenly drops traces, that's why. Swap the key in your dev config before Monday and restart the collector. The new Spanwick key is below.

gateway credential: kto7_GoY89Me

Service accounts — SpokeShift rebalancer. Welcome aboard. The SpokeShift tool decides which vans move bikes between docks overnight in the Calver Bay network. It runs under the spokeshift-ops service account, which needs three permissions: read on dock telemetry, write on van assignments, and read on the weather feed. Please never run it under your personal account, even for testing, since audit trails assume the service identity. The account authenticates against the internal DockGraph telemetry service using the key that appears below.

gateway credential: kto3_qfe

## Step 4: Flush the stale tier

Quick recap from the Bramblewick postmortem: the edge cache in Fennel kept serving week-old entries because the TTL override never propagated after the failover. Annoying, but fixable. Before you restart the workers, double-check the invalidation window is set correctly on every node. Here are the current production settings for the Fennel cache layer.

deployment values, yadug-bawif:
[framir]
team = pelox
access_code = ac_a38ab2
owner = tamion.julael
host = framir.tolvaqlabs.test
port = 11211
peer = tammir.zemvargrid.local
salt = 2215ef03
pin = 1541

New folks: the banner config lives in the compliance-ui repo, and rollout percentages are managed through Driftgate's staged flags, not the old dashboard. No user-facing errors reported, just missing banners in the Pellwick and Ostrevane regions. Suspected cause is a stale flag snapshot cached by the edge tier. Rollback is not needed; we only need a cache flush and re-push. The trace token from the affected deploy follows.

build token for kagaf-hahof: htk14_9d3d4d26d7d8de